A Brief History of Baccarat
The game of baccarat traces its roots back to the 19th century, although some sources suggest it was played as early as the 1400s in Italy. Initially a game for aristocrats, baccarat gained fame in French salons before eventually becoming a casino staple. How to Play Baccarat
Baccarat is a comparing card game played between two hands, the "player" and the "banker". Each baccarat coup (round of play) has three possible outcomes: "player" (player has the higher score), "banker", and "tie". Here's a quick overview of how the game unfolds:
- Players place their bets on either the player, banker, or tie. Sometimes optional side bets may be available.
- The dealer distributes two cards each to the player and banker hands.
- The objective is to bet on the hand that you believe will have a total value closest to nine.
- If either hand has a total of 8 or 9, this is called a "natural", and no further cards are drawn.
- If not, a third card may be drawn based on the house rules.
- The hand with the higher total wins, and payouts are made accordingly.
Card Values and Scoring
The cards have the following point values in baccarat:
- Aces are worth 1 point.
- Cards 2 through 9 retain their face values.
- 10s, Jacks, Queens, and Kings are worth 0 points.
To calculate the total value of a hand, simply add the values of the cards. If the total exceeds 9, only the last digit is considered. For example, a hand consisting of a 7 and a 6 results in a total of 13, thus the score is 3.
Diverse Variations of Baccarat
While traditional baccarat has simple rules, numerous variations have emerged over the years, making the game even more engaging:

- Chemin de Fer: Mostly found in European casinos, players take on the role of the banker in rotation. Each player gets to draw, and the decision-making element adds richness to the game.
- Baccarat Banque: Similar to Chemin de Fer, with the difference being that the banker position is permanent and not rotational. This version features three decks of cards.
- Mini Baccarat: A smaller-scale version popular in the US, it brings the excitement of baccarat to players unwilling to risk large wagers. The rules are similar, and the gameplay faster, making it ideal for online platforms.

Strategies for Winning at Baccarat
While baccarat is largely a game of chance, players often adopt certain strategies to enhance their odds of winning:
- Bet on the Banker: Statistically, the banker bet is slightly more favorable, with a house edge of about 1.06%. It's the safest bet in baccarat, albeit with a commission on winnings.
- Avoid the Tie Bet: Although offering tempting payouts, the tie bet comes with a prohibitively high house edge, making it a risky choice.
- Money Management: Setting clear limits on losses and wins can prevent overspending and ensure a sustainable gaming experience.
- Seeing Trends: While patterns in wins and losses may appear, baccarat is inherently unpredictable, and players should exercise caution when setting their wagers based on perceived trends.
